The Swedish vehicle manufacturer\u2019s efforts to reduce its environmental impact can be traced back more than 75 years.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3 style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><strong>A History of Sustainability<\/strong><\/span><\/h3>\n<figure class=\"article-img\" style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><img class=\"wrapImageCMS aligncenter\" src=\"https:\/\/fleetimages.bobitstudios.com\/upload\/automotive-fleet\/custom-media\/volvo\/10-2021-sponsored-article\/450px_picture2-__-720x516-s.png\" alt=\" - \" \/><\/span><\/figure>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">Volvo has long been recognized as a leader in automotive safety, from the introduction of three-point seat belts in 1959 to today\u2019s crash avoidance and mitigation technologies. At the same time, the company has been working to offset its environmental impact.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">For example, Volvo has been offering <strong>remanufactured exchange parts<\/strong> since 1945, when the company began renovating gearboxes in the Swedish town of K\u00f6ping. That novel idea has blossomed into one of the most extensive remanufactured parts programs in the industry, the Volvo Cars Exchange System.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">Other company milestones in sustainability over the decades have included: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ul style=\"text-align: justify;\">\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">1972 \u2014 Volvo made its <strong>first environmental declaration<\/strong> at the UN\u2019s first Environment Conference in Stockholm.<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">1976 \u2014 Volvo introduced its <strong>three-way catalytic converter with the Lambda sensor<\/strong>, reducing harmful emissions by up to 90%.<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">1991 \u2014 Volvo launched the first car with <strong>no ozone-depleting chlorofluorocarbons (CFCs)<\/strong>, and then eliminated CFCs entirely from its product line in 1993.<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">1996 \u2014 Volvo began setting <strong>environmental requirements for its suppliers<\/strong>.<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">2008 \u2014 All of Volvo\u2019s European manufacturing plants have been running on <strong>hydro-electric power <\/strong>since 2008.<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">2018 \u2014 Volvo\u2019s engine plant in Sk\u00f6vde, Sweden, became <strong>climate-neutral<\/strong> \u2014 the first in the company\u2019s global manufacturing network to achieve that milestone.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">While Volvo has been taking steps to reduce its environmental impact for more than 75 years, now the company is working toward the most ambitious sustainability goals in its history.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">\n<h3 style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><strong>Electric Vehicle Revolution <\/strong><\/span><\/h3>\n<figure class=\"article-img\" style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><img class=\"wrapImageCMS aligncenter\" src=\"https:\/\/fleetimages.bobitstudios.com\/upload\/automotive-fleet\/custom-media\/volvo\/10-2021-sponsored-article\/577px_picture6-__-720x516-s.png\" alt=\" - \" \/><\/span><\/figure>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">For Volvo, the future is electric. One of the company\u2019s key goals is to become a fully electric car manufacturer by 2030 \u2014 just over eight years from now.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">Of course, such a fundamental change doesn\u2019t happen overnight. Volvo\u2019s EV revolution is already underway.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">In 2019, the company introduced its <strong>first fully electric SUV<\/strong>, the Volvo XC40 Recharge pure electric, which could travel about 250 miles per charge.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">Volvo hit another electrification milestone in 2019: <strong>Every new Volvo car launched from that year onward has an electric motor<\/strong>. The company\u2019s lineup now includes mild hybrids, plug-in hybrids, and pure electric vehicles.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">On the path to full electrification by 2030, the company has an incremental target for its <strong>car sales to comprise about 50% pure electric and 50% hybrid by 2025<\/strong>.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">Volvo\u2019s EV initiative will ultimately eliminate tailpipe emissions from its new cars, but that only accounts for part of the company\u2019s carbon footprint. To truly become climate neutral, Volvo is making changes across its entire value chain.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3 style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><strong>Comprehensive Emission Cuts<\/strong><\/span><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">For all automakers, emissions come not only from their vehicles\u2019 tailpipes, but also from the full gamut of producing and delivering the vehicles to market.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">For Volvo, another step on the way to climate neutrality is to <strong>cut the lifecycle carbon footprint of its vehicles by 40%<\/strong> from 2018 to 2025. The overall reduction per vehicle will consist of: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ul style=\"text-align: justify;\">\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">50% from tailpipe emissions<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">25% from raw materials and suppliers<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">25% from total operations, including logistics<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">For the supply chain factor, Volvo is <strong>encouraging its top suppliers to use 100% renewable energy<\/strong> by 2025, and to reuse and recycle more materials. As for its own operations, Volvo is targeting <strong>climate-neutral manufacturing in all its plants <\/strong>by 2025.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">The company is also adopting a circular economy approach \u2014 recovering parts and materials at the end of a car\u2019s useful lifespan and reusing them in the production of new vehicles. This ties in with another sustainability-related goal for Volvo: <strong>to become a circular business by 2040<\/strong>.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">On that front, Volvo is boosting its use of recycled and bio-based materials. By 2025, the company plans to compose its new cars of: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ul style=\"text-align: justify;\">\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">25% recycled or bio-based plastic<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">40% recycled aluminum<\/span><\/li>\n<li><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">25% recycled steel<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">One of Volvo\u2019s circular economy initiatives is a new leather-free material for its next-generation cars. The material consists of textiles made from recycled material such as PET bottles, bio-attributed material from sustainable forests in Sweden and Finland, and corks recycled from the wine industry.<\/span><\/p>\n<figure class=\"article-img\" style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><img class=\"wrapImageCMS aligncenter\" src=\"https:\/\/fleetimages.bobitstudios.com\/upload\/automotive-fleet\/custom-media\/volvo\/10-2021-sponsored-article\/500px_picture5-__-720x516-s.png\" alt=\" - \" \/><\/span><\/figure>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">Reusing and recycling materials not only contributes to the company\u2019s sustainability goals \u2014 it also makes good business sense.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">\u201cOur adoption of the circular economy will help support our profitability,\u201d Templar says. \u201cWe estimate that from 2025, adoption of circular economic principles, including remanufacturing, recycling, and reuse, will generate savings of over $100 million annually \u2014 as well as reduce carbon emissions by 2.5 million tonnes [about 2.75 million U.S. tons] each year.\u201d<\/span><\/p>\n<h3 style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><strong>Sustainability Is Key to Survival<\/strong><\/span><\/h3>\n<figure class=\"article-img\" style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><img class=\"wrapImageCMS aligncenter\" src=\"https:\/\/fleetimages.bobitstudios.com\/upload\/automotive-fleet\/custom-media\/volvo\/10-2021-sponsored-article\/555px_car-on-dam-1-__-720x516-s.png\" alt=\" - \" \/><\/span><\/figure>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\">For Volvo, the safety of drivers and passengers remains a top priority.
